Material Reality Check
Authentic Prada uses proprietary Pocono nylon—a durable, water-resistant material with specific texture and sheen. Budget Kakobuy options typically use generic nylon that feels thinner and less substantial. The mid-range options come closer, but still lack the distinctive hand-feel of genuine Pocono.
Texture and Weight Discrepancies
The most noticeable difference is weight. Authentic Prada nylon bags have a satisfying heft despite being lightweight. Budget replicas feel almost papery, while premium options overcompensate and feel too heavy. The texture also differs—authentic bags have a subtle matte finish with slight grain, whereas replicas often appear too shiny or completely flat.
Hardware Concerns
This is where budget options truly falter. The triangular Prada logo plaque should be made from enamel-filled metal with precise lettering. Budget versions use lightweight metal that tarnishes quickly, with font inconsistencies visible even in product photos. The Re-Edition Specific Issues
The Re-Edition line presents unique authentication challenges that make replicas easier to spot. The iconic triangle logo should sit at a specific angle with precise stitching. Many Kakobuy options show crooked logos or uneven stitching patterns.
